Top 5 Cooking Games Performance in Germany Q2 2022
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 cooking games on a unified platform in Germany during Q2 2022,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the second quarter of 2022, the top 5 cooking games in Germany demonstrated varied performance in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at how each app fared:
Cooking Diary® Restaurant Game by Mytona Limited saw a peak in weekly revenue at the end of March with approximately $39K. However, this number gradually declined, reaching around $25K by the end of June. Weekly downloads fluctuated, starting at 1.5K in late March and dipping to a low of 770 in late May before bouncing back to over 1K in late June. The app's active users also showed a downward trend, dropping from 22.8K to 17.6K over the quarter.
My Cafe — Restaurant Game from Melsoft experienced a significant increase in weekly revenue, starting at $23K at the end of March and rising to almost $29K by the end of June. The app's weekly downloads were strong, peaking at 7K in late May and maintaining around 4.5K to 6.5K throughout the quarter. Active users grew steadily, from 17.6K at the end of March to nearly 20K by the end of June.
Cooking Madness-Kitchen Frenzy by ZenLife Games Pte. Ltd. saw consistent weekly revenue, ranging between $19K and $24K. The app's weekly downloads started high at 36K but showed a decline, reaching 9.4K by the end of June. Despite the drop in downloads, active users remained strong, fluctuating around 76K to 87K throughout the quarter.
Love & Pies - Merge Mystery from Trailmix Ltd saw a gradual decline in weekly revenue, starting at $17K at the end of March and dropping to around $13K by the end of June. Weekly downloads increased significantly, from 1.7K at the end of March to over 3K in mid-June. Active users followed a similar upward trend, growing from 27K to 33K over the quarter.
Cooking Fever: Restaurant Game by Nordcurrent UAB maintained a steady weekly revenue, averaging around $10K to $12K. Weekly downloads showed a decreasing trend, starting at 17K and dropping to 9.5K by the end of June. Active users also saw a decline from 128K to 103K over the same period.
